Electrical Terminology
• Voltage – Electrical pressure in a circuit
(Measured in volts)
• Current – Flow of electrons moving past a
point in a circuit (Measured in amperes)
• Resistance – Opposition to the flow of
electrons (Measured in ohm’s)
• Circuit – A complete path that controls the
rate and direction of electron flow

Ignition Module Coils
• Primary winding
– 74 Turns
• Secondary winding
– 4,400 Turns
– Connects to spark plug
• 60:1 Step-up
Transformer
• Trigger coil opens the
circuit for the primary
winding

Breaker Point Ignition Systems
• When points are closed,
magnetic field builds up
in primary winding
• When points open,
magnetic field in
primary winding
collapses thru
secondary winding
• This creates enough
voltage to fire the spark
plug

Magnetron® Ignition Systems
(USED ON THIS ENGINE)
• Electronic module which
replaced points and
condenser
• Module acts like switch
– Opens and closes circuit
on the primary winding
